This review is from: Gandhi and the Gita (Paperback)
Indian thinkers are, or used to be, expected to translate the Gita. As to whether each interpretation is "satisfactory" is really a silly question. Gandhi was surrounded by recognized scholars, such as Vinoba Bhave, Chakravarti Rajagopalachari, and Mahadev Desai. Each of these had his own interpretation of the Gita, and none of them presumed to denigrate Gandhi's.
